Shooting Near Jamestown
Jamestown, CA -- Tuolumne County Sheriff's are on the scene of an apparent self inflicted gunshot wound.
It happened around 8 am on Jacksonville Road South of Jamestown. Sheriff's officials report a man has shot himself in the chest.
They are releasing few details on the incident. An ambulance is on the scene.

Update 8:35 a.m.: Sheriff's officials report air ambulance just landed in Jamestown to take victim to Modesto Hospital.
Update 9 a.m.: Sheriff'f officials report an air ambulance just took off from Jamestown with with the victim and it is headed to Doctors Medical Center in Modesto. There is no word on his condition.
Update 9:45 a.m.: Sheriff's officials are not releasing the victims name or additional information on the incident saying they cannot comment on an ongoing investigation.
